During such a tense period, it was easy to trigger a chain reaction.

Xu Xinyao strongly agreed and nodded, "No wonder Yuan Hao was able to transport people in secretly."

Although the residence of the leader of the biggest gang paled in comparison to the Prime Minister’s Mansion in Jingjiang City, it still covered a large area.

As they walked past several courtyards, the group finally entered the rear hall where the host lived.

Little bridges over flowing water, elegant pavilions among the clouds, and stone paths leading straight to the hall ahead.

Suddenly,

a middle-aged man with half black and half white hair emerged from the hall ahead, his face marked by a scar, carrying a subtle aura of murderous intent.

He perfectly matched Xu Yuan’s impression of a gang boss.

The scout leading the way immediately whispered an introduction:

"Third Young Master, this man is the leader of the Pingshui Gang. I shall take my leave now."

"Mhm, you may go."

Xu Yuan nodded and halted, watching the other man approach.

"Bai Zhao, has met the Third Young Master."

The middle-aged man stopped close by and, instead of kneeling, gave a deep bow with his hands clasped.

This was probably the difference between the Black Scale Guards and the Black Scale Army.

Tian’an Martial Hall not only taught disciples the ways of cultivation but also fostered their collective consciousness and loyalty, particularly loyalty to Xu Yinhè alone.

The specific methods were thoroughly analyzed by aides of the Prime Minister’s Mansion, subtly influencing without triggering any resistance from the apprentices.

And after coming out from the Tian’an Martial Hall and entering the Black Scale Army, this subtle influence would be even more meticulously applied.

Upon meeting a direct descendant of the Prime Minister’s Mansion, most would perform the kneeling salute.

Whereas Lou Ji’s Black Scale Guards differed from the Black Scale Army, with most being tightly bound together by common goals and interests, as well as threats of death following betrayal.

Turning game into reality, after understanding these things, Xu Yuan always felt that his father was a pure force of nature descending from the heavens.

A main character of a world completely different from Qin Mo’s.

No wonder Xu Changge didn’t dare to make a peep most of the time in front of Xu Yinhè.

This from a small Sect from Jingjiang Prefecture, step by step grew into a behemoth...

Some thoughts ran too far,

Xu Yuan looked at the middle-aged man with half-grey hair in front of him and smiled, "Where is Captain Yuan?"

"Captain Yuan is over here," Bai Zhao smiled and gestured invitingly.

Xu Yuan led the way, with Bai Zhao following by his side.

Pausing for a moment, Xu Yuan looked at the servants in the courtyard and asked softly, "Is it alright for these servants to see us?"

Upon hearing the question, Bai Zhao smiled and replied,

"No problem, they are either illiterate deaf-mutes from nearby or confidants I have cultivated over the years."

"Deaf-mutes?" Xu Yuan was surprised.

Bai Zhao smiled candidly, "It garners some good reputation, and they won’t leak any secrets."

As they walked, Xu Yuan glanced at him and asked,

"Did you build up the Pingshui Gang on your own?"

Bai Zhao smiled humbly, "Just luck, my status today is inseparable from Yi Tian’s support."

Xu Yuan raised an eyebrow.

Yi Tian, the underling of Aunt Lou Ji, a minor boss in the evil path storyline of Cang Yuan early on.

Obviously, this man’s status within the Black Scale ranks wasn’t high enough to make direct contact with Lou Ji.

But that didn’t stop Xu Yuan from admiring him, for he could sense that this man’s cultivation was merely Seventh Grade.

A man in his forties who was Seventh Grade likely would have been weaker in his youth, and the Black Scale Guards wouldn’t have poured much resources into such a freely sown seed, and lacking in martial prowess, to establish such a large gang without power meant only his wits remained.

Reflecting on this, Xu Yuan said,

"Very impressive."

Bai Zhao, seeing the gesture, showed a hint of surprise in his eyes, and then, with respect, clasped his fists and quietly said,

"Thank you for your praise, Third Young Master."

Xu Yuan shook his head and continued forward, asking quietly,

"How many people did Captain Yuan bring into the city this time?"

"Over three thousand five hundred."

Bai Zhao replied immediately without hesitation.

Although that Captain Yuan had only mentioned that the Third Young Master would come and hadn’t specified what the Third Young Master was here for, under such circumstances, it was unlikely that someone of the Third Young Master’s noble status would come here with no particular purpose.

Therefore, the Third Young Master must have come to take command.

After all, it seemed like a war was about to begin.

Hearing the number three thousand five, Xu Yuan was somewhat surprised by the large number of people, but then he raised an eyebrow:

"How shall we arrange them?"

"Most are hidden in Pingshui Bay, while the rest I have arranged to stay in various inns throughout the city. The Spiritual Blades and weapons that I have collected over the past twenty years are just enough to equip them," Bai Zhao replied truthfully.

Xu Yuan opened his mouth to speak but before he could say anything, he suddenly saw a little girl with her hair in a topknot running out of the back yard, followed by a flustered woman.

As the little girl ran towards Bai Zhao, she called out happily:

"Daddy..."

"...."

Seeing the little girl, a touch of affection surfaced in Bai Zhao’s eyes, but he didn’t immediately go to meet her, instead casting a probing glance at Xu Yuan beside him.

Xu Yuan shook his head to indicate it was fine, and then Bai Zhao quickly stepped forward.

Father and daughter laughed and played for a while, and after Bai Zhao had sent his daughter away, he returned to Xu Yuan and said:

"Forgive me for the late arrival of my daughter, Young Master."

"It’s no trouble."

Xu Yuan smiled slightly and asked:

"Didn’t you send your family away in advance?"

"It’s too dangerous," Bai Zhao replied honestly.

Xu Yuan watched as the woman carried the little girl away, and asked:

"Isn’t it more dangerous to stay in Wanxiang City now?"

Bai Zhao’s eyes narrowed slightly as he said:

"No, Third Young Master, I mean the plan. My identity is special, my family usually resides in the city, and there might be people watching. Sending them away now, if discovered, might compromise the Prime Minister’s plan."

"....."

Silence.

Xu Yuan narrowed his eyes, once again sizing up the middle-aged man with half-white hair in front of him.

The 3,500 Black Scale Army soldiers entering the city, whether they actually take action or not, are a sword that must be laid out on the negotiating table.

In other words,

afterwards, the Myriad Manifestation Sect would certainly investigate.

They haven’t been discovered yet because the Myriad Manifestation Sect has not found any traces of the large-scale movement of troops, and they are not yet alert.

If a thorough investigation is indeed conducted, it is very likely that it will lead back to the Pingshui Gang.

If the Sects really decided to deal with such an urban underground gang, it would be like crushing an ant.

With this thought, Xu Yuan raised his hand and patted the other man’s shoulder, but did not speak, continuing to walk forward in silence.

After being patted on the shoulder, Bai Zhao just silently followed, but a barely noticeable smile crept into his downcast eyes.

When they arrived at a courtyard,

Bai Zhao bowed to Xu Yuan once again:

"The Commander Yuan Hao is inside, I will take my leave now."

Xuan Yuan nodded and said:

"Arrange a courtyard for the two of them."

He didn’t plan to have Xu Xinyao take part in this negotiation.

Ran Qingmo said nothing but silently nodded.

Xu Xinyao, on the other hand, seemed somewhat opposed:

"Third Brother, I also..."

"Be obedient." Xu Yuan glanced back at her, his gaze allowing no room for defiance.

Xu Xinyao then left with Ran Qingmo.

Xu Yuan watched the graceful figures of the two women walking away, then slowly pushed open the door of the courtyard.

The courtyard had a pond with koi swimming around, the water clear and the pond’s center featured a pavilion.

Stepping in, Xu Yuan’s gaze immediately locked onto the man in the pavilion.

He had a delicate appearance, looked very young, dressed in a scholar’s robe, sitting in the pavilion, tending to a small fire stove, enjoying his wine alone.

A scholar?

Xu Yuan looked surprised and instinctively glanced around to see if there were other people in the courtyard.

At this moment, the man had already put down his wine cup, stood up, and bowed from afar to Xu Yuan at the entrance of the courtyard:

"Third Young Master, stop looking. I am Yuan Hao."

"...."

Xu Yuan withdrew his gaze and looked again towards the man in the pavilion. As he walked towards the pavilion, he said:

"Commander Yuan’s appearance is somewhat unexpected."

The delicate-looking man gave a light smile:

"Is it because my appearance doesn’t match the rumors that I enjoy killing?"

"A little."

Xu Yuan nodded, entering the pavilion and inspecting the man before him:

"Rather than a commanding officer, you look more like a scholar from the Hanlin Academy, and besides, you’re too young."
